The contract pertains to the procurement of PIN, SHOULDER, HEADLESS items with NSN 5315-01-416-8190, quantity of 182 units, under solicitation SPE4A6-26-T-06UY, issued by the Defense Logistics Agency’s ASC Commodities Division. Delivery is required within 170 days after award, with the solicitation posted on July 15, 2026, and responses due by July 23, 2026. The place of performance is specified as Texarkana, Texas, with Ericka Mosley as the primary point of contact. Technical and quality requirements are governed by the DLA Master List of Technical and Quality Requirements, with applicable revisions determined by the solicitation or award date depending on acquisition size. The contract incorporates critical cybersecurity and export control mandates including Cybersecurity Maturity Model Certification (CMMC) Level 2, requiring either a self-assessment or certification by a C3PAO. Packaging must comply with DLA standards, and supplies must be physically marked per RQ017, with government identification removed from non-accepted items under RQ011. Technical data associated with this item is subject to export control under ITAR or EAR, restricts disclosure to foreign persons, and mandates compliance with DFARS 252.225-7048. Access to such data is limited to contractors approved by DLA, holding valid US/Canada Joint Certification Program credentials, and who have completed mandatory training and completed the DLA Export-Controlled Technical Data Questionnaire. Tailored higher-level quality requirements apply to both manufacturers and non-manufacturers, and all work is subject to federal acquisition regulations.

Solicitation SPE7LX-26-U-9815 is a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Business set-aside issued by the Department of Defense, specifically the DLA Land and Maritime Strategic Acquisition Program Directorate. The requirement is for the procurement of 56 metallic solid wheels, identified by NSN 5340010635825. This is a unilateral Indefinite Delivery Contract with a maximum value of 350,000 dollars, a guaranteed minimum quantity of 8 units, and a minimum delivery order quantity of 14 units. Delivery is expected within 210 days after receipt of the order, with inspection and acceptance occurring at the destination. The contract mandates strict adherence to several technical and regulatory standards, including CMMC Level 2 certification and the prohibition of Class I ozone-depleting chemicals. Packaging and marking must comply with MIL-STD-2073-1E, MIL-STD-129, and DLA packaging requirements, with specific attention to special packaging instruction AK10635825. Technical data is subject to ITAR and EAR export controls, requiring approved US/Canada Joint Certification Program certification for access. Invoicing and payment must be processed electronically through the Wide Area WorkFlow system. Additionally, offerors must comply with the Buy American Act and the Berry Amendment, providing disclosure for any non-domestic materials used.

Solicitation SPE7L7-26-Q-2418 is a firm-fixed-price request for quotations issued by the Defense Logistics Agency Land and Maritime for the procurement of sealed lead acid storage batteries, identified by NSN 6140-01-624-9682. The requirement consists of two line items totaling eight units, with two units for item 0001 and six units for item 0002. Approved sources include EnerSys Delaware Inc. (part numbers ODS-AGM6M or PC2250) and Stored Energy Products, Inc. (part number PC2250). These items are designated as critical application items and are restricted source items requiring engineering source approval by the government design control activity. The batteries are classified as Type I (Code H) with a non-extendable shelf life of 12 months. Delivery is required within 60 days after receipt of the order, with shipping terms set as FOB Destination. Packaging and marking must comply with MIL-STD-2073-1E, MIL-STD-129, and DLA packaging requirements RP001, while hazardous materials must be handled according to IP025 and FAR 52.223-3. Quality assurance will be managed through destination inspection and acceptance using sampling methods such as MIL-STD-1916 or ASQ H1331. Award will be based on cost alone for quotes that conform to the solicitation requirements. Quotations must be submitted by September 21, 2026, and payment will be processed electronically via the Wide Area WorkFlow system.
